Baltimore Officials Pull Fake AI Campaign Ads

Baltimore election officials have removed artificial intelligence-generated political advertisements that were circulating in local media ahead of upcoming elections, according to WBAL-TV 11 NBC. The AI-created content reportedly contained misleading information that could have influenced voter decisions, prompting swift action from city supervisors to protect the integrity of the democratic process. Officials expressed concern about the growing sophistication of AI technology being used to create deceptive campaign materials that are increasingly difficult for voters to identify as fake. The incident highlights urgent challenges facing Black communities and other vulnerable populations who may be disproportionately targeted by sophisticated disinformation campaigns designed to suppress voter participation or spread false narratives about candidates and ballot issues.
